We are urgently recruiting for an Executive Administrative Assistant to work with our client within a corporate bank. This is truly an exciting opportunity for the right individual to join one of the biggest financial institutions of today on an on-going, temporary rolling contract.

You should have a minimum of 5+ years corporate Executive Administrative Assistant within corporate financial and banking institutions with a strong work ethic and common-sense approach. Support requirements will vary from day to day, dependent on the business needs. Ideally, you will have a solid PA background and skill set with a strong degree of flexibility.

Your role and responsibilities:
Professional client handling and relationship building with all clients, Bankers and admin cover groups
* Full competency in diary management, can apply good judgment and has an understanding of competing priorities.
* Strong, executive communication style
* Experience of effectively arranging travel, production of accurate itineraries, plan B & C, able to navigate systems well and apply good judgment on how to optimise travellers time and business costs.
* Can demonstrate pro-activity and ownership within the role
* Strong technical capabilities.
* Awareness of expense arena, expense systems and cost control initiatives e. can champion expense policy, process expenses in a timely manner and reconcile accounts accurately on a monthly basis.
* Polished, professional approach, calm and composed manner, ability to work in a pressured environment and partner effectively with peers.
* Exhibits a positive, common sense, constructive attitude to drive bankers schedule and help manage time effectively.
* Is flexible, willing and receptive to change.
* Can follow up without prompting and keep 1 step ahead of arrangement and requirements, displays good use of initiative and follow through to completion.
* Has a high level of attention to detail and delivers high quality results.
* Has an understanding of the culture of Investment Banking and the Corporate Bank
* Is a strong team player who can build networks and work in partnership with peers, management and senior stakeholders.
* Solution orientated.
* Is driven and can manage expectations through communicating proactively and often across different hierarchies.
* Can quickly grasp the political landscape and key people within the organization
* Has potential to act as a role model to their peers e. lead by example
